According to 6Wresearch internal database and industry insights, the Global Shale Stabilizer Market was valued at USD 1.2 Billion in 2024 and is expected to reach USD 1.7 Billion by 2031, growing at a compound annual growth rate of 3.40% during the forecast period (2025-2031).
The Global Shale Stabilizer Market is experiencing steady growth due to the increasing demand for shale stabilizers in the oil and gas industry. Shale stabilizers are chemicals used in drilling operations to prevent shale formations from swelling or collapsing, thereby improving drilling efficiency and wellbore stability. The market is driven by the rising exploration and production activities in shale gas and tight oil reservoirs, particularly in regions such as North America, Europe, and Asia-Pacific. Key players in the market are focusing on developing innovative products to enhance drilling performance and reduce environmental impact. Additionally, stringent regulations regarding drilling fluid disposal and environmental protection are further propelling the market growth. The market is expected to continue its growth trajectory in the coming years as the oil and gas industry expands its operations globally.

Government policies related to the Global Shale Stabilizer Market vary by country, with regulations typically focusing on environmental protection, safety standards, and resource management. In the United States, for example, the Environmental Protection Agency (EPA) sets guidelines for the use of shale stabilizers to minimize their impact on water quality and wildlife habitats. In Canada, regulations by the National Energy Board (NEB) aim to ensure the safe extraction and transportation of shale gas resources. In Europe, countries like the UK and Poland have specific legislation governing shale gas exploration and production, including requirements for environmental impact assessments and community consultations. Overall, government policies in the Global Shale Stabilizer Market aim to balance economic development with environmental sustainability and public safety concerns.
